Originating as a significant coal mining and industrial hub, West Bromwich now boasts a rich blend of historical sites and modern attractions. The city is home to the Sandwell Valley Country Park, which spans 268 hectares and offers scenic landscapes, walking trails, and wildlife watching opportunities.
A prime location for visitors, West Bromwich offers convenient access to Birmingham City Centre and various regional attractions.
